Answered by Alex Gustafson, member, from VT, United States, on May 18, 2021

No it does not come with a "threaded" bolt catch roll pin, just a standard one. But your lower should have come with one pre-installed in the bolt catch hole. If you purchase an "Aero Precision field repair kit", it will come with a threaded bolt catch roll pin as well as the set screw that adjusts lower to upper slop ( the very little slop that exists with this company ) and a bunch of other useful spare parts.
